Charles Hunter Associates Ltd is seeking a Supervising Social Worker for a Fostering Team in Exeter, United Kingdom. The role involves overseeing and supporting foster carers to ensure children receive safe and high-quality care.

Candidates must have:

  • A degree in Social Work
  • At least 3 years of post-qualifying experience
  • A UK driving licence

The position offers up to £38 per hour, hybrid working, and supportive management.
